Zenith Bank Marks 20th Anniversary with Health Walk in Accra

Staff, management, and customers of Zenith Bank (Ghana) Limited on Saturday took to the streets of Accra for a 10-kilometre health walk to commemorate the bank’s 20th anniversary.

Themed “20 Years of Impact, A Lifetime of Shared Growth,” the walk began at the bank’s Head Office, Zenith Heights, Ridge, and took participants through key city routes, including the Ridge Roundabout, Accra Financial Centre, Independence Avenue, and the Ako Adjei Interchange, before looping back to the starting point.

Mr Henry Oroh, Managing Director of Zenith Bank Ghana, said the walk formed part of a series of activities planned to celebrate two decades of the bank’s operations in Ghana.

He explained that the exercise was designed to promote wellness, teamwork, and social engagement among staff and customers, while also celebrating the bank’s achievements and resilience.

“Zenith Bank’s success story is not only about financial performance but about the people who make the journey worthwhile,” Mr. Oroh said.
“The walk symbolises the shared energy, resilience, and partnership that have sustained the bank for 20 years.”

Highlighting the bank’s progress, he noted that Zenith’s 20-year milestone reflects a legacy of innovation, service excellence, and community development, cementing its place as a leading financial institution in Ghana’s banking sector.

Mr Oroh described the anniversary as a moment to reflect on the bank’s journey, one “fueled by vision, driven by innovation, and anchored in service excellence.”

“Today, we have walked to honour the strides we have made, strides that have transformed Ghana’s banking landscape and elevated the Zenith brand into one of strength, innovation, and trust,” he said.

He reaffirmed the bank’s commitment to maintaining a strong capital adequacy ratio well above regulatory requirements, ensuring continued financial stability and resilience.

The Managing Director also commended the media for their support in sharing Zenith Bank’s impact and success stories over the years.

The event featured free medical screening and wellness tips for participants. Customers who joined the walk praised the bank for maintaining strong relationships with clients and for initiatives that promote good health and corporate social responsibility.
